Upcoming software purchases should no longer be one-time contracts; they're living partnerships built on shared data and trust.
SDLC guides teams to plan, build, test, and deliver software. Discover phases, KPIs, tools, and checklist with our quick start guide. Picture this: You and your team have spent a tremendous amount of ...
Pressure grows for software better aligned with business. Agile techniques have been stagnant for a decade. AI may speed up Agile team output. Agile has always had the best intentions: work side by ...
Community driven content discussing all aspects of software development from DevOps to design patterns. Apache Struts is one of the most popular web development frameworks in the history of the Java ...
Learn how AI supports every stage of software development and why it’s a powerful coding partner for developers. AI is changing how software is built, tested, and maintained. AI tools help developers ...
Considering the scaling history and trajectory of generative AI models (specifically large language models, or LLMs) specialized for coding, the software development life cycle (SDLC) is ripe for ...
Many developers and project managers focus on building functional code and shipping products rapidly, while overlooking the importance of maintaining detailed, precise, and comprehensive documentation ...
Software development models are a collection of techniques and organizational systems for creating computer software. The goal of the various approaches is to structure work teams so that they can ...